Lee Hi leaves YG for AOMG... New song 'Hollo' released today at 6 PM
[Asia Economy Intern Reporter Kang Juhee] Singer Lee Hi has officially confirmed her exclusive contract with AOMG after leaving YG Entertainment.
On the 22nd at 10 PM, AOMG announced through their official YouTube channel that "Singer Lee Hi is joining AOMG as a new artist," and released a video.
The released video features Lee Hi in a dreamy atmosphere as if she is in space. Her uniquely sweet and resonant voice captivates the listeners.
Also, Lee Hi is set to release her new song "Hollo" at 6 PM today (the 23rd), marking her first activity under AOMG.
AOMG stated, "We are happy to work with Lee Hi. She has been an artist we have admired for a long time," and added, "We will provide full support so that Lee Hi can engage in broader and more active musical activities."

Meanwhile, Lee Hi gained great popularity after appearing on SBS's audition program "K-pop Star" in 2012. She later debuted as a solo singer under YG Entertainment, releasing hit songs such as "Breathe," "Rose," and "Hold My Hand."
